Aug. 22nd, 2004 @ 02:12 am Metallica vs. the Beastie Boys
Current Music: Portishead - Over
So Thursday a friend of mine calls me and asks what I'm doing on Friday night. "Nothing," I say, "why, you wanna hang out?" Then he says, "I got an extra ticket for the Metallica show in Milwaukee, you wanna go?" I thought it was strange that he had tickets for the Milwaukee show since he lives in Chicago, but I didn't question it. I quickly replied in the affirmative before he decided otherwise. I later found out that he got the Milwaukee tickets cause they were about $20 cheaper than the Chicago show next weekend. Anyway, the show was incredible. I hadn't seen Metallica since '89. What was especially cool is that we were less than 15 feet from the stage. It was awesome...and free!

In other news, I'm currently doing a series of Beastie Boys remixes. So far I've done a mix of Ch-Check It Out which has an old school vibe to it; and Sure Shot, which is one of my favorites, which is well...different! My favorite mix of that song is the Prunes Mix off the Tour Shot import (it's on the US Sure Shot EP, but only in instrumental form.) So, rather than try to do the song in a style that's already been done (and likely fall horribly short,) I decided to take a completely new approach to it. The mixes are available for streaming or download at my ACIDplanet site. More mixes to come!
